Why is your opel astra 1.6 overheating?
Your Opel Astra 1.6 may be overheating due to several reasons, including low coolant levels, a malfunctioning thermostat, or a failing water pump. A clogged radiator or a broken radiator fan can also impede proper cooling. Additionally, a leak in the cooling system or a blown head gasket might contribute to overheating issues. It's essential to diagnose the problem promptly to prevent engine damage.
Why is Vauxhall astra not getting enough fuel?
There could be several reasons why a Vauxhall Astra isn't getting enough fuel. Common issues include a clogged fuel filter, a failing fuel pump, or a malfunctioning fuel pressure regulator, all of which can restrict fuel flow to the engine. Additionally, problems with the fuel injectors or a blocked fuel line may also contribute to insufficient fuel delivery. It’s advisable to have a mechanic diagnose the issue to identify and resolve the specific cause.

How do you change the oil in 2000 astra ts where is the plug?
To change the oil in a 2000 Astra TS, first ensure the car is on a level surface and secure it with jack stands. Locate the oil drain plug underneath the vehicle, typically found at the bottom of the oil pan on the engine's underside; it may require a 13mm or 15mm socket. Remove the plug carefully and allow the old oil to drain completely into a pan. Once drained, replace the plug, refill the engine with new oil through the oil filler cap, and check the dipstick for the correct level.
Where is the location of oxygen sensor of an opel astra 2004?
In a 2004 Opel Astra, the oxygen sensor is typically located in the exhaust system. There are usually two sensors: one is positioned before the catalytic converter (upstream) and the other is after the catalytic converter (downstream). The upstream sensor is often found on the exhaust manifold or just after it, while the downstream sensor is located further along the exhaust pipe. Always consult the vehicle's service manual for precise locations and specifications.

Opel Astra 2.0 8 valve Engine Overheating?
Overheating in an Opel Astra 2.0 8-valve engine can be caused by several factors, including a malfunctioning thermostat, a failing water pump, or a clogged radiator. Insufficient coolant levels or a coolant leak can also contribute to the issue. It's essential to check for any visible leaks, ensure the cooling system is filled to the recommended level, and inspect the radiator and hoses for blockages or damage. If the problem persists, a thorough diagnosis by a professional mechanic is advised to avoid further engine damage.

How many liters of petrol would it take for an Opel Astra to travel 15000 miles?
To estimate the fuel needed for an Opel Astra to travel 15,000 miles, you first need its fuel efficiency, which is typically around 30 miles per gallon (mpg). Dividing 15,000 miles by 30 mpg gives you 500 gallons. Since there are approximately 3.785 liters in a gallon, you would multiply 500 gallons by 3.785 liters, resulting in about 1,893 liters of petrol needed for that journey.
